"The government is the potent omnipresent teacher.  For good or ill it teaches the whole people by its example.  Crime is contagious.  If the government becomes a lawbreaker, it breeds contempt for the law;  it invites every man to become a law unto himself;  it invites anarchy.  To declare that the end justifies the means -- to declare that the government my commit crimes -- would bring terrible retribution."

Qouted:   Justice Louis D. Brandeis (1856-1941) United States Supreme Court Justice - Olmstead v. United States, 277 US 438, 1928
